(specifically the "black" version) is a hardware security key required to run Wilcom’s professional-grade embroidery software. In the world of industrial digitizing, this dongle serves as your license; without it, the software will not open or will only run in a restricted "viewer" mode. What is the Wilcom e2 Dongle?
